Babylon’s soldiers will be killed in Babylon.
    They will be badly injured in Babylon’s streets.
The Lord God of heaven’s armies
    did not leave Israel and Judah alone.
They are fully guilty of leaving the Holy One of Israel.
    But he has not left them.

“Run away from Babylon!
    Run to save your lives!
    Don’t stay and be killed because of Babylon’s sins.
It is time for the Lord to punish Babylon.
    Babylon will get the punishment it deserves.

They will fall(A) down slain in Babylon,[a]
    fatally wounded in her streets.(B)
For Israel and Judah have not been forsaken(C)
    by their God, the Lord Almighty,
though their land[b] is full of guilt(D)
    before the Holy One of Israel.

“Flee(E) from Babylon!
    Run for your lives!
    Do not be destroyed because of her sins.(F)
It is time(G) for the Lord’s vengeance;(H)
    he will repay(I) her what she deserves.
